Safe Mode Problem

hi, I'm having a bit of a problem with XP, it boots normally and without problem under a normal boot. But under safemode it boots to the logon screen where just when it loads up the icons for me to login, it reboots. It happens with all three safemode options. Also before I get to this screen, during the black screen where it shows all the drivers being loaded I get an SPTD.sys load error. Please help!

Re: Safe Mode Problem

Hi, I found that by uninstalling SPTD using the the SPTD Layer installer/Uninstaller, no crash. Hope this helps anyone else. Mods please mark as closed/resolved.
